Ruslan Stefanchuk, Speaker of the Verkhovna Rada of Ukraine (Ukrainian parliament), has said he discussed the security situation in Ukraine with Lorenzo Fontana, President of Italy's Chamber of Deputies, including the possibility of jointly supporting the building of an underground school in one of Ukraine's frontline regions.

Source: Stefanchuk on X (Twitter)

Details: Stefanchuk said they discussed the consequences of Russian attacks on Ukrainian cities, exchanged views on the next stages of the peace process and coordinated their positions.

Quote: "We also discussed the protection of Ukrainian children. We considered the possibility of jointly supporting the building of an underground school in one of Ukraine's frontline regions as part of the Shelter Coalition."

Details: Stefanchuk also stressed the need to maintain sanctions pressure on Russia and deepen interparliamentary cooperation between Ukraine and Italy.
